What is the SBA $10,000 grant?

It's important to know that the SBA primarily offers loan guarantees, not grants for general business startups. While specific disaster relief programs may offer grants, most business funding comes in the form of loans that need to be repaid. What does an SBA loan mean?

An SBA loan signifies that the Small Business Administration guarantees a portion of the loan provided by a bank or other lender. This guarantee reduces lender risk, often leading to more accessible funding and better terms for small businesses. It's a crucial tool for economic development in cities like St. Louis.

What is an SBA loan?

An SBA loan is a business loan partially guaranteed by the U.S. Small Business Administration. This guarantee encourages lenders to offer capital to small businesses that might otherwise face challenges securing traditional financing. The SBA itself doesn't lend the money directly; they back a portion of the loan made by a partner lender, making it accessible for entrepreneurs in St. Louis.
